What is the Finder bar on Mac?

The Finder is the first thing that you see when your Mac finishes starting up. It opens automatically and stays open as you use other apps. It includes the Finder menu bar at the top of the screen and the desktop below that.

How do I get rid of the top bar on my second screen Mac?

MacOS: How to Turn Off the Menu Bar on an External Display Print Go to the System Preferences and choose "Mission Control" Uncheck the box next to "Displays Have Separate Spaces" Close the Preferences. Choose "Log Out" from the Apple Menu. Log back in as you would normally. .

How do I stop Finder action on Mac?

Force quit Finder from the Apple menu Open Finder. Click on the Apple menu icon → press and hold the Shift key. Select the Force Quit Finder command. The Finder will restart. Also, you can use the Option+Shift+Command+Esc (⌥⇧⌘⎋) key combination to force close Finder. .

How do you see hidden files on Mac?

View Hidden Files in Finder In Finder, you can click your hard drive under Locations, then open your Macintosh HD folder. Press Command + Shift + . (period) to make the hidden files appear. You can also do the same from inside the Documents, Applications, and Desktop folders.

What does the Mac Pro Touch Bar do?

The Touch Bar is a Retina display and input device located above the keyboard on supported MacBook Pro models. Dynamic controls in the Touch Bar let people interact with content on the main screen and offer quick access to system-level and app-specific functionality based on the current context.

What does displays have separate spaces mean on Mac?

Displays have separate Spaces. Set up separate spaces for each display (if you use Spaces and have multiple displays). This option must be selected if you want to use apps in Split View on your other displays.

How do you drag the menu bar on a Mac?

How to Rearrange Icons in the Menu Bar Hold down the Command (⌘) key. Hover your mouse cursor over the icon you want to move. Holding down the left mouse button, drag the icon into your preferred position on the menu bar. Other icons will step aside to make space for it. Let go of the left mouse button. .

Why can't I eject my hard drive Mac?

If you can't eject an external disk or storage device On your Mac, choose Apple menu > Log Out, then log in again. Try to eject the disk again. If you still can't eject the disk, choose Apple menu > Shut Down. Disconnect the disk from your computer, then start up your computer again.

When Mac is frozen?

How to quickly unfreeze your Mac Press Command- Esc-Option on your keyboard at the same time, then release them. Select the name of the frozen application from the menu's list and click Force Quit. If the Force Quit menu doesn't appear or the frozen program doesn't close, you'll need to restart your computer. .
